A number of new coordination compounds with transition-metal salts and triazole-based heterocyclic ligands is described. The ligands used are disubstituted [1,2,4]triazolo[1,5-a]pyrimidines, with as substituents: ethyl, methyl and phenyl, and in addition a 2-methylthio-dimethyl ligand was used (sdmtp). To determine the structures of the coordination compounds in a number of cases 3D crystal structure determinations have been carried out, i.e. for [Fe(NCS)2(detp)3(H2O)], [Co(NCS)2(sdmtp)2(H2O)], [ZnBr2(fmtp)2], [Ni(NCS)2(detp)3(CH3OH)] and [Fe(NCS)2(fmtp)2(H2O)2](fmtp). The latter compound is quite unusual as it contains an uncoordinated fmtp ligand in the crystal lattice with special packing features. The ligands and the coordination compounds have been further characterized by NMR, IR and LF spectra, as well as by C, H, N element analyses. The coordination around the metal varies from 4 (Zn), via 5 (Co) to 6 (for Ni and Fe).
